Abstract

This paper presents a dynamic rate selection (DRS) scheme to determine the transmission rate of video multicast services for ultra‐wideband (UWB) systems. The DRS scheme utilizes the received signal quality of the beacon frame sent by each UWB device to estimate clients’ location distribution. It then determines the best data rate to transmit the enhancement layer portion of the multicast video stream. Considering the limited processing power of the USB device, a decision tree is further proposed to reduce the computational complexity of the DRS. The performance of the DRS scheme is verified via computer simulation. Simulation results demonstrate the effective of the proposed DRS scheme in various conditions.
